    Working principle of high frequency transformer

    The high frequency transformer is the most important part of the switching power supply. The switching power supply generally uses a half-bridge power conversion circuit. When working, two switching transistors are turned on in turn to generate a 100kHz high-frequency pulse wave, and then the high-frequency transformer is used to step down and output low-voltage alternating current.

    The Critical Role of EMC Line Filters in Ensuring Electronic Device Compliance and Reliability

    EMC line filters are far more than simple accessory components added to a bill of materials. They are fundamental, active engineering elements that sit at the critical junction between a device and the unpredictable external electrical world. Their role in achieving and maintaining regulatory compliance is clear and mandatory. However, their deeper value lies in their contribution to intrinsic product reliability: by creating a protected internal power environment, they shield sensitive electronics from degradation and malfunction, directly extending product lifespan and ensuring consistent performance. In an era where electronics underpin everything from infrastructure to daily life, investing in proper EMC filtering—through careful selection, correct integration, and validation—is a decisive step in designing products that are not only lawful to sell but are also trustworthy, durable, and fit for purpose in the real world. It is an investment in product integrity and customer confidence.

    The Essential Role of Split-Core Ground Fault Protection CTs in Enhancing Electrical Safety

    Split-core ground fault protection CTs are far more than mere measurement components; they are dynamic, intelligent sentinels embedded within the electrical infrastructure. By providing a reliable, non-invasive means to detect the dangerous imbalance of ground fault currents, they serve as the critical link between electrical energy and human safety. Their unique design makes advanced electrical protection feasible for both new installations and, more importantly, for the vast landscape of existing systems where safety upgrades are most needed but most challenging. From preventing fatal shocks to averting catastrophic fires and ensuring the uptime of critical operations, the deployment of these sensors represents a fundamental commitment to safety, reliability, and proactive risk management. In essence, the split-core CT is a key enabler in building a safer, more resilient, and code-compliant electrical world.
